Imgur is a public image and GIF community, and a link can look a few different ways — imgur.com/a/xxxxx for an album, imgur.com/gallery/xxxxx for a gallery post, imgur.com/xxxxx for a single image, or a direct i.imgur.com/xxxxx.jpg file. SnapSave reads any of these.

Paste the Imgur link and SnapSave finds the original image Imgur stores on its own servers — the full-size file the uploader first added — and returns it untouched. A photo or meme comes back as JPG or PNG, and an animated post comes back as a looping GIF. The output keeps the source format and the original uploaded quality, so a large HD image stays HD.

A screenshot is only the on-screen copy

A screenshot saves the scaled, on-screen version, while SnapSave fetches the original file behind it, which is the whole reason your download stays sharp.

Quality depends on the upload

SnapSave always returns the largest version Imgur holds, but it cannot go past what was posted. If the original image is small, that size is the ceiling — no tool can add detail that was never there.
